ballot.upgrade

Contains upgrade tasks that are executed when the application is being upgraded on the server. See onegov.core.upgrade.upgrade_task.

Module Contents

Functions

alter_domain_of_influence(→ None)

rename_yays_to_yeas(→ None)

add_shortcode_column(→ None)

enable_translation_of_vote_title(→ None)

add_absolute_majority_column(→ None)

add_meta_data_columns(→ None)

add_municipality_domain(→ None)

add_party_results_columns(→ None)

add_status_columns(→ None)

add_candidate_party_column(→ None)

rename_candidates_tables(→ None)

add_ballot_title(→ None)

add_content_columns(→ None)

add_vote_type_column(→ None)

change_election_type_column(→ None)

replace_results_group(→ None)

change_counted_columns_of_elections(→ None)

add_region_domain(→ None)

renmame_elegible_voters_columns(→ None)

add_party_results_to_compounds(→ None)

add_panachage_results_to_compounds(→ None)

add_update_contraints(→ None)

migrate_election_compounds(→ None)

add_default_majority_type(→ None)

add_delete_contraints(→ None)

add_related_link_and_label(→ None)

add_after_pukelsheim(→ None)

add_district_and_none_domain(→ None)

add_last_result_change(→ None)

add_voters_count(→ None)

cleanup_pukelsheim_fields(→ None)

add_manual_completion_fields(→ None)

change_voters_count_to_numeric(→ None)

add_superregion_to_election_results(→ None)

add_total_voters_count(→ None)

change_total_voters_count(→ None)

add_party_id_column(→ None)

add_party_name_translations(→ None)

remove_obsolete_party_names(→ None)

add_gender_column(→ None)

add_year_of_birth_column(→ None)

add_exapts_columns(→ None)

add_domain_columns_to_party_results(→ None)

drop_party_color_column(→ None)

add_foreign_keys_to_party_results(→ None)

add_foreign_keys_to_panahcage_results(→ None)

drop_owner_from_party_results(→ None)

drop_owner_from_panachage_results(→ None)

add_type_election_relationships(→ None)

remove_old_panachage_results(→ None)

fix_file_constraints(→ None)

add_external_ids(→ None)

add_external_ballot_ids(→ None)

change_nullable_ballot(→ None)

add_compound_id_to_elections(→ None)

drop_election_compound_assocations(→ None)

ballot.upgrade.alter_domain_of_influence(context: onegov.core.upgrade.UpgradeContext, old: Sequence[str], new: Sequence[str]) None[source]
ballot.upgrade.rename_yays_to_yeas(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_shortcode_column(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.enable_translation_of_vote_title(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_absolute_majority_column(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_meta_data_columns(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_municipality_domain(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_party_results_columns(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_status_columns(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_candidate_party_column(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.rename_candidates_tables(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_ballot_title(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_content_columns(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_vote_type_column(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.change_election_type_column(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.replace_results_group(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.change_counted_columns_of_elections(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_region_domain(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.renmame_elegible_voters_columns(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_party_results_to_compounds(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_panachage_results_to_compounds(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_update_contraints(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.migrate_election_compounds(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_default_majority_type(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_delete_contraints(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_after_pukelsheim(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_district_and_none_domain(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_last_result_change(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_voters_count(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.cleanup_pukelsheim_fields(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_manual_completion_fields(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.change_voters_count_to_numeric(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_superregion_to_election_results(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_total_voters_count(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.change_total_voters_count(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_party_id_column(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_party_name_translations(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.remove_obsolete_party_names(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_gender_column(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_year_of_birth_column(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_exapts_columns(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_domain_columns_to_party_results(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.drop_party_color_column(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_foreign_keys_to_party_results(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_foreign_keys_to_panahcage_results(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.drop_owner_from_party_results(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.drop_owner_from_panachage_results(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_type_election_relationships(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.remove_old_panachage_results(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.fix_file_constraints(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_external_ids(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_external_ballot_ids(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.change_nullable_ballot(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.add_compound_id_to_elections(context: onegov.core.upgrade.UpgradeContext) None[source]
ballot.upgrade.drop_election_compound_assocations(context: onegov.core.upgrade.UpgradeContext) None[source]